Output d7031d1161baabe6171dc48baaa22622bb9bf8d1d4158fcfaafec56676553bd2:13

value
2259261
script pubkey
OP_0 OP_PUSHBYTES_20 af653cc8016b2bed77a766a4727a090d7b5c9ac7
address
bc1q4ajnejqpdv476aa8v6j8y7sfp4a4exk82zdwkq
transaction
d7031d1161baabe6171dc48baaa22622bb9bf8d1d4158fcfaafec56676553bd2
confirmations
261297
spent
true